Equally suitable for spontaneous work as well as for large ambitious studio paintings, oils are perhaps the most versatile of all paints. And yet for many painters, their use is shrouded in mystery, while others regard them as "difficult" medium. This book, now back by popular demand, sets out to show that, with proper instruction, nothing could be further fom the truth.

The key to mastery of the medium is a full understanding of the constituents of oil painting - binders, dilutents, varnishes, mediums, driers - and their properties, all of which are clearly explained and illustrated with over 200 colour images, backed up by comprehensive information on supports, equipment and techniques.
